Severability <br />Provided this Grant can be executed and performance of the obligations of the Parties accomplished within <br />its intent, the provisions hereof are severable and any provision that is declared invalid or becomes <br />inoperable for any reason shall not affect the validity of any other provision hereof. <br />K. Tazes <br />The State is exempt from all federal excise taxes under IRC Chapter 32 (No. 84-730123K) and from a11 <br />State and local government sales and use taxes under CRS §§39-26-101 and 201 et seq. Such exemptions <br />apply when materials are purchased or services rendered to benefit the State; provided however, that certain <br />political subdivisions (e.g., City of Denver) may require payment of sales or use taxes even though the <br />product or service is provided to the State. Grarrtee shall be solely liable for paying such taxes as the State <br />is prohibited from paying for or reimbursing Grantee for them. <br />M. Third Party geneficiaries <br />Enforcement of this Grant and all rights and obligations hereunder are reserved solely to the Parties, and <br />not to any third part�,. Any services or benefits which third parties receive as a result of this Grant are <br />incidental to the Grant, and do not create any rights for such third parties. <br />N.
